| One of the many things I offer, I believe is the most important part is that ALL of my jewelry is Made using the Virgin Process, meaning my jewelry, while its being made, is never touched by human skin. I wear hand protection and face mask to ensure that when you receive your jewelry, your skin cells and your oils are the only ones to have made contact with the wood. The reason for that is, since the wood is porous, it has microscopic pores, and as it is being made or worn it is collecting any and all skin cells that touch it, any and all bodily oils and it deposits it in the surface of the wood. I don't know if you have ever heard that you are not supposed to wear another persons' organic jewelry but its true, the reason being that their skin is all in the surface of that jewelry, if someone else were to wear that jewelry your skin could have a negative effect to their body chemistry among many other things. So I wanted to keep with that same idea and take my process a step further. So when you receive your jewelry, you can be confident that it will have your chemistry ALONE. Body jewelry made of wood has great versatility. It is lightweight, so even a largely stretched piercing can be accommodated without discomfort. Wood comes in a variety of colors and hardness, depending on the source, which can be anything from the reedy bamboo to the rock-solid ebony. Although most raw woods are relatively safe,
there are some that could be considered toxic when brought into contact
with the skin, especially for a duration. I ensure that I am well
versed on the subject and guarantee my product to be safe.
